file-type

MATLAB变量操作与文件存取详解

MD文件

2KB | 更新于2024-08-03 | 93 浏览量 | 0 下载量 举报 收藏
download 立即下载
MATLAB是一种广泛应用于数值计算、数据处理和科学编程的高级编程语言和环境。本文档主要讲解了MATLAB中变量的管理和文件存取操作。在MATLAB中,变量的创建和操作是基础,它支持创建各种数据类型(如整数、向量、矩阵等),并通过简单的语法进行访问、修改和运算。例如,可以像下面这样创建和操作变量: ```matlab % 变量创建和操作 x = 10; % 声明并初始化一个变量 y = [1, 2, 3, 4, 5]; % 创建一个一维向量 disp(x); % 显示变量值 disp(y(2)); % 访问向量的第2个元素 y(3) = 100; % 修改元素值 z = x + y; % 进行基本数学运算 ``` MATLAB对于文件的处理同样方便,特别是处理数据文件和图像文件。`load`函数用于从文本文件(如`.txt`)中读取数据,例如: ```matlab data = load('data.txt'); % 从文本文件加载数据 ``` 而`imread`函数则用于加载图像文件,如JPEG或PNG格式: ```matlab image = imread('image.jpg'); % 从图像文件加载图像 ``` 要保存数据,MATLAB提供了`save`函数,它可以将变量存储为MAT格式的文件,如`result.mat`: ```matlab result = [1, 2, 3, 4, 5]; % 创建要保存的数据 save('result.mat', 'result'); % 保存数据到MAT文件 ``` 图像数据可以通过`imwrite`函数保存为新的图像文件: ```matlab imwrite(image, 'new_image.jpg'); % 保存图像到新文件 ``` 在整个过程中,确保文件路径与MATLAB脚本位于同一目录下,以简化文件操作。这些基本操作能够帮助用户有效地管理数据和文件,无论是进行数据分析还是图像处理工作。通过熟练掌握MATLAB的变量与文件存取,你可以更高效地完成各种科学计算和工程任务。

相关推荐

html+css+js网页设计
  • 粉丝: 1851
上传资源 快速赚钱